Cleaning options
Some of the top robot mop models feature dual spinning pads which can scrub and sweep floors. These are better in removing dirt than flat cloth-style pads and are able to tackle the mess of coffee spills, dried ketchup and pet hair. They also have larger tanks of water and are compatible with a wide range of cleaning products that can be bought at your local store.
Most models have a mobile application that allows you to save your home's maps and create cleaning schedules. You can also make use of the app to alter the robot's settings and monitor its progress. Some even feature voice control, like Alexa. It is important to look for these features when choosing mop robots.
A robot with multiple mopping styles is good option. A robot that can be used in multiple mopping options will be able to handle all kinds of flooring surfaces, including tile, laminate and wood. A mop that doesn't have this capability might not be able to deal with all types of floor coverings and will most likely require more frequent replacement of mop pads.
Consider the amount of maintenance needed to keep your robot mop in good condition. Some mops require you to clean the dust bins and mop pads manually, while others are simple to maintain and self-emptying. You should also make sure that the mops don't get left wet and exposed for too long in order to avoid mold and bacteria growth.
Some of the top robots that mops come with an intelligent system that allows them to avoid carpets. They can raise their mopping units and stop dispensing solution when they encounter carpet, which means they don't get stuck, or soak the carpet with too much water. You can also use the app to create no-go zones in areas where you don't want your mop to go. These functions are especially helpful for those who have flooring that is mixed in your home.
